
Waning Coal Demand in Asia Pushes Global Trade Down for the First Time in 21 Years
Coal loses support as demand in China falters The global coal trade declined for the first time in 21 years in 2014, and likely contracted further this year as well, according to information from the Energy Information Administration (EIA).
